Arlington House. Near Fine in Near Fine dust jacket. 1974. Hardcover. 0870002295 . Hardcovers in dust jackets. First 1974 edition. Books are in near fine condition, crisp and clean, with tight bindings and sharp corners. Minor age-toning and edgewear present. Large 8vos. In protective Mylars.; Volumes 1-4; 8vo 8" - 9" tall; 2644 pages .
